Bruins fans, what's the word on that Lysell guy? I see his stats in the AHL were pretty decent this year.

He took a step forward in his development this year. He got publicly called out by the coach earlier in the season for not playing more of a team game and after that, Lysell's game took off. Unfortunately, he got hurt when it looked like he was a viable candidate for getting a callup and then got hurt again in the AHL playoffs on a play that could have been a suspension. IMO, he has the highest ceiling of the Bruins prospects but his injury history is a growing concern. Kid is very talented and has elite level speed.
